Rondel dagger handles usually were made of wood plated with metal or of metal, although wood, horn, and bone models existed, too. The contemporary post-mortem on the remains of King Richard III show that at the Battle of Bosworth in 1485 he suffered a rondel wound to the head before other fatal wounds. Rondel blades were often in the twelve to sixteen inch range and appear to have often been used in an "ice pick" style overhand grip. The term Rondel is derived from the medieval English word 'roundel', meaning round or circular, and relates to the unique shape of the hand-guard which sits above and below the grip. A rondel dagger /ˈrɒndəl/ or roundel dagger was a type of stiff-bladed dagger in Europe in the late Middle Ages (from the 14th century onwards), used by a variety of people from merchants to knights.
